我正在使用 json 文件获取数据,其中一个变量是关于时间的,例如 19:00,如 GMT+0。如果我想将其转换为 GMT+2,我需要添加 2,但我不知道如何...我正在尝试在 Titanium 项目中执行此操作。
问问题
382 次
3 回答
1
var time = "19:00";
function incHour(t,hr){ return parseInt(hr) + 2; }
time = time.replace( /^(\d{1,2})/, incHour );
于 2013-03-28T21:04:24.887 回答
1
我总是推荐 momentjs,如果你认为你将不得不做更多的时间操作
于 2013-03-29T02:09:04.763 回答
0
参考:如何将 30 分钟添加到 JavaScript 日期对象?
var d1 = new Date ('6/29/2011 4:52:48 PM'),
d2 = new Date ( d1 );
d2.setHours ( d1.getHours() + 2 );
alert ( d2 );
于 2013-03-28T21:00:41.580 回答